9 Reasons Why Muay Thai Is The Perfect Martial Art

The ancient martial art of Muai Thai, developed over centuries, is known for its immense power, maximum efficiency and raw simplicity. Often referred to as the “Art of the Eight Limbs”, Moi Thai uses a beautiful symphony of kicks, punches, knees and elbows with fluidity and grace.

Muay Thai is today one of the most well-known and practiced martial arts in the world. It has proven to be effective, which is why it is the most common and prominent base in the most popular, fast-growing sport, of mixed martial arts.

2) It is effective in all combat ranges in standup.

A Moai Thai fighter kicks a heavy bag during training.

During a Thai Mui class, you will practice kicks, knees, elbows and punches.

Mui Thai is a martial art and martial art unlike any other sport. The art combines the use of knees, elbows, calves and hands. This allows the practitioner to use all the weapons available to the human body in kick range, punch range and clinch, making it effective in all stand-up combat ranges unlike most injury-based martial arts.

5) It is both aerobic and anaerobic training.

Amir Khan throws a kick during a Moai Thai class at Evolve MMA.

Muai Thai Gym is a place to push yourself to the limit to become the best version of yourself.

Muay Thai is specifically designed to promote the level of fitness and toughness required for ring competition even for recreational practitioners. With running, rope jumping and shadowboxing it provides aerobic training to prepare you for more intense training. Muay Thai also builds great anaerobic endurance with exercises like boxing and kicks on the pads or bags, and clinging to run your body to the limit.

This makes Muay Thai, not only a perfect martial art, but also a very effective form of exercise. With continuous training, Muay Thai will significantly improve your cardiovascular strength, skill and performance.
